Join us at Thermo Fisher Scientific as a Field Service Engineer, where you'll contribute by ensuring our sophisticated scientific instruments operate at peak performance. In this role, you'll represent our company, delivering exceptional technical service while building strong relationships with customers who are advancing critical research and innovation. You'll install, maintain, and repair a diverse range of high-value analytical instruments, from electron microscopes to chromatography systems. You'll combine technical expertise with customer service skills to solve complex problems and help our customers achieve breakthrough discoveries that make the world healthier, cleaner, and safer. Education/Experience: Bachelor's Degree, no prior experience required. Experience installing, troubleshooting, and repairing sophisticated analytical instruments preferred Preferred Fields of Study: Engineering (Electrical, Electronics, Mechanical, Biomedical) or related scientific field Advanced degrees or specialized certifications are a plus Strong electronics and mechanical aptitude with ability to diagnose issues down to component level Knowledge, Skills, Abilities: Excellent customer service skills and professional demeanor Strong verbal and written communication abilities Fluency in English required; additional language skills welcome Demonstrated problem-solving capabilities and analytical thinking Proficiency with Windows operating systems, MS Office, and service management software Ability to read and interpret technical diagrams, schematics and documentation Valid driver's license and ability to travel up to 50-75% Physical ability to lift up to 50 lbs and stand for extended periods Experience with ultra-high vacuum systems and high voltage equipment preferred Availability to work flexible hours and respond to emergency service calls Must be able to obtain necessary credentials to access customer facilities Strong organizational skills and ability to manage time effectively Collaborative mindset with ability to work independently Compensation and Benefits The hourly pay range estimated for this position based in New York is $27.91–$41.86.
